I bought a box of these sticks pretty soon after they came out. To be honest, I was not that impressed with the smoke when I got it. I guess I bought the box because there was so much hype surrounding it and I had some cash to spare. They are, however, well-constructed cigars. I did not have any burning issues and the ash stacked pretty well. I really liked the draw and I got delightful amounts of smoke. Also, the leather-bound box was really cool, so I knew that this cigar had some potential.

After about six months or so, I came back to 80th. This time around I enjoyed it so much more. There is a full range of flavors with this cigar but you will probably pick up on some spice pretty early on (seemingly earthy, too). Now, I do not know if I am making this part up or not but I recall getting a sort of fruity taste on my lips (WARNING: I might be full of crap on that one). Typing this message makes me want to smoke one right now. The only thing that is a little annoying is that the bands have good taste and really want to stay attached to the cigar. I gave a few of these smokes to my brother and still have 5 or so left. I will have to reward myself with one soon.
